Texture

The gelatinous texture of Honduran sea moss is a defining characteristic that contributes to its unique properties and applications. This texture results from the high content of polysaccharides, particularly agarose and carrageenan, within the algae’s cell walls. These polysaccharides form a network that traps water, creating a gel-like consistency.

  • Culinary Applications: The gelatinous texture of Honduran sea moss makes it an excellent thickener and gelling agent in various culinary preparations. It is commonly used in soups, sauces, and desserts to add texture and enhance consistency.
  • Nutritional Value: The polysaccharides in Honduran sea moss are not only responsible for its texture but also contribute to its nutritional value. These polysaccharides are dietary fiber, which supports digestive health and promotes satiety.
  • Medicinal Properties: The gelatinous texture of Honduran sea moss may have potential medicinal applications. Studies have suggested that the polysaccharides in sea moss may have anti-inflammatory and antiviral properties, supporting immune function and overall health.
  • Industrial Uses: Beyond culinary and medicinal applications, the gelatinous texture of Honduran sea moss has industrial uses. It is employed as a thickener and stabilizer in various products, including c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, and paints.

In summary, the gelatinous texture of Honduran sea moss is a result of its polysaccharide content and contributes to its culinary, nutritional, medicinal, and industrial applications. Understanding this texture provides insights into the versatile nature and potential benefits of this unique algae.

Medicinal uses

Honduran sea moss has gained recognition for its potential medicinal properties, particularly in supporting thyroid health and boosting the immune system.

  • Thyroid Health:

    Honduran sea moss is a rich source of iodine, an essential mineral for thyroid hormone production. Iodine deficiency can lead to hypothyroidism, a condition characterized by fatigue, weight gain, and impaired cognitive function. Incorporating Honduran sea moss into the diet may help ensure adequate iodine intake and support optimal thyroid function.

  • Immune Support:

    Honduran sea moss contains antiviral and antibacterial compounds that may enhance immune function. Studies have shown that certain polysaccharides found in sea moss can stimulate the production of immune cells, such as macrophages and natural killer cells, which help fight infections and protect against diseases.

The medicinal properties of Honduran sea moss make it a valuable addition to a holistic health regimen. By supporting thyroid health and boosting immunity, sea moss contributes to overall well-being and resilience against various ailments.

FAQs on Honduran Sea Moss

This section addresses frequently asked questions about Honduran sea moss to provide comprehensive information and clarify common misconceptions.

Question 1: What is Honduran sea moss?

Honduran sea moss is a species of red algae (Gracilaria edulis) native to the waters of Honduras. It is known for its nutrient-rich composition and potential health benefits.

Question 2: What are the nutritional benefits of Honduran sea moss?

Honduran sea moss is an excellent source of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. It is particularly rich in iodine, which is essential for thyroid health, as well as iron, calcium, and potassium.

Question 3: How can Honduran sea moss be used?

Honduran sea moss can be consumed in various ways. It can be added to smoothies, soups, and salads, or taken as a supplement in capsule or powder form.

Question 4: Is Honduran sea moss sustainably sourced?

Yes, Honduran sea moss is sustainably sourced through farming practices in Honduras. This approach minimizes environmental impact and ensures the long-term availability of this valuable resource.

Question 5: Are there any potential risks or side effects associated with consuming Honduran sea moss?

Honduran sea moss is generally considered safe for consumption. However, excessive intake may lead to iodine toxicity, especially in individuals with thyroid conditions. It is recommended to consult a healthcare professional before consuming large amounts of sea moss.

Question 6: Where can I buy Honduran sea moss?

Honduran sea moss can be purchased from health food stores, online retailers, and some grocery stores. When choosing a product, look for Honduran sea moss that is sustainably sourced and processed.

Summary: Honduran sea moss is a nutrient-rich superfood that offers potential health benefits. It can be incorporated into a healthy diet in various ways and is sustainably sourced through farming practices in Honduras. As with any dietary supplement, it is essential to consume Honduran sea moss in moderation and consult a healthcare professional if you have any concerns.

Tips for Incorporating Honduran Sea Moss into Your Diet

Honduran sea moss is a nutrient-rich superfood that offers a range of potential health benefits. Here are a few tips to help you incorporate this unique ingredient into your diet:

Tip 1: Start Gradually: Begin by adding small amounts of Honduran sea moss to your smoothies, soups, or salads. Gradually increase the quantity as your body adjusts to the increased fiber intake.

Tip 2: Choose High-Quality Products: Opt for Honduran sea moss that is sustainably sourced and processed. Look for products that are free from additives and preservatives.

Tip 3: Experiment with Different Forms: Honduran sea moss is available in various forms, including fresh, dried, and powdered. Experiment with different forms to find what works best for your needs and preferences.

Tip 4: Add to Smoothies: Honduran sea moss is an excellent addition to smoothies. Its mild flavor and thickening properties create a creamy and nutritious beverage.

Tip 5: Enhance Soups and Stews: Use Honduran sea moss as a thickener and flavor enhancer in soups and stews. It adds body and richness without overpowering other ingredients.

Summary: Incorporating Honduran sea moss into your diet is a great way to boost your nutrient intake and support your overall health. By following these tips, you can easily enjoy the benefits of this unique superfood.
